3.13 Unplugging the Cutterbar
The cutterbar is located on the front of the header. It supports the knife and guards which are used to cut the crop.
DANGER
To prevent bodily injury or death from the unexpected start-up or fall of a raised machine, always stop the engine and
remove the key before leaving the operators seat, and always engage the safety props before going under the
machine for any reason.
WARNING
Wear heavy gloves when working around or handling knives.
IMPORTANT:
Lowering a rotating reel on a plugged cutterbar will damage the reel components.
To unplug the cutterbar, reverse the windrower. If the cutterbar is still plugged, do the following:
1. Stop the forward movement of the machine and disengage the header drives.
2. Raise the header to prevent it from filling with dirt, and engage the header drive clutch.
3. If the plug does NOT clear, disengage the header drive clutch and fully raise the header.
4. Shut down the engine, and remove the key from the ignition.
5. Engage the headers safety props.
6. Clean off the cutterbar by hand.
NOTE:
If cutterbar plugging persists, refer to 8 Troubleshooting, page 259.
